How to Use This Template
Start with objectives
Define what students will be able to do by the end of the lesson. Use measurable action verbs. Every activity should connect back to these objectives.
Plan backwards from assessment
Decide how you will know students learned. Then design activities that build toward that assessment. This ensures alignment between teaching and evaluation.
Time each activity
Assign realistic time blocks. Include buffer time for transitions. If a lesson feels rushed, cut content rather than speeding through it. Depth beats breadth.
Reflect and iterate
After each lesson, spend 2 minutes noting what worked and what to change. These notes make next year's lesson planning dramatically faster and better.

Frequently Asked Questions
What are the essential components of a lesson plan?
An effective lesson plan includes learning objectives (what students will be able to do), materials needed, an opening hook to engage students, instructional activities with timing, guided and independent practice, assessment methods to check understanding, and a closing/reflection. Differentiation strategies for varying skill levels should also be included.
How far in advance should I plan lessons?
Ideally, plan at least one week ahead so you have time to gather materials and adjust based on student progress. Many educators plan unit outlines 2-4 weeks in advance, then detail individual lessons weekly. Having a template makes weekly planning faster and ensures consistency across lessons.
How do I write measurable learning objectives?
Use the ABCD format: Audience (who), Behavior (what they will do), Condition (under what circumstances), and Degree (how well). Use action verbs from Bloom's Taxonomy: identify, analyze, create, evaluate. Avoid vague verbs like "understand" or "learn." Example: "Students will be able to solve two-step equations with 80% accuracy."
